Specifications
Series: WE-WPCC
Part Status: Active
Function: Receiver
Type: 1 Coil, 1 Layer
Inductance: 11µH
Tolerance: ±10%
DC Resistance (DCR): 180 mOhm
Q @ Freq: 30 @ 125kHz
Current Rating: 2.5A
Current - Saturation: 4A
Frequency - Self Resonant: 16MHz
Operating Temperature: -20°C ~ 105°C
Size / Dimension: 1.34" L x 1.04" W x 0.04" H (34.00mm x 26.50mm x 0.89mm)
